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it 3fd6b694 authored by Cooper Yuan's avatar Cooper Yuan Committed by Inki Dae
Browse files

drm/exynos: fix buffer pitch calculation

parent 0dd3b72c
Loading
Loading
Loading
Loading
+1 −1
Original line number Original line Diff line number Diff line
@@ -668,7 +668,7 @@ int exynos_drm_gem_dumb_create(struct drm_file *file_priv,
	 *	with DRM_IOCTL_MODE_CREATE_DUMB command.
	 *	with DRM_IOCTL_MODE_CREATE_DUMB command.
	 */
	 */


	args->pitch = args->width * args->bpp >> 3;
	args->pitch = args->width * ((args->bpp + 7) / 8);
	args->size = PAGE_ALIGN(args->pitch * args->height);
	args->size = PAGE_ALIGN(args->pitch * args->height);


	exynos_gem_obj = exynos_drm_gem_create(dev, args->flags, args->size);
	exynos_gem_obj = exynos_drm_gem_create(dev, args->flags, args->size);